"Pup Champs: Adorable Football Puzzler Hits iOS, Android Soon"

Author : Elijah Apr 25,2025

Get ready for a delightful twist on the football genre with Pup Champs, an upcoming release for iOS and Android that combines the charm of adorable pups with the excitement of football. Launching on May 19th, this game isn't your typical sports simulator; instead, it's a captivating puzzler that challenges you to guide your team to the goal through strategic passes and crosses, all while dodging tackles from the opposing team.

Designed to be accessible for everyone, even those unfamiliar with football's offside rule, Pup Champs offers an engaging experience for casual fans and seasoned players alike. The game also features an inspiring underdog story, where you step into the shoes of a retired soccer coach mentoring a team of young pups on their journey to becoming amateur football champions.

Pup Champs will be available as a free-to-start game, initially offering 20 puzzles to kick off your adventure. While the concept of mixing pups with football might seem like a natural fit in our cuteness-obsessed world, especially following the success of events like the Puppy and Kitten Bowl, Pup Champs surprises by focusing on puzzle-solving rather than sports simulation.

Developed by Afterburn, the team behind acclaimed titles such as Railbound, Golf Peaks, and Pulsar, Pup Champs promises not only adorable aesthetics but also a high level of gameplay quality. So, if you're looking for a game that's both stylish and skillfully crafted, Pup Champs is definitely worth checking out.
